Weird War is a classic RPG with loads of action and is set during the Second World War. It's a game brimming with adventures and humor but also with many battles. The hero of the game manages to board a German submarine after a torpedo destroys his boat. It soon becomes apparent that the submarine is on a secret mission to Africa. This is where the story begins, quickly leading to a wild adventure involving the Wunderwaffe, ancient artifacts, Leon the trusty Camel and many squash...
The game combines an atmosphere of adventure like that found in "Raiders of the Lost Ark" with a unique brand of humor made popular by the "Allo, Allo" Television series, creating a refreshing and lighthearted perspective of World War II. Weird War - the Unknown Episode of World War II, is similar to classic RPGs such as Baldur's Gate, Arcanum and Planescape Torment. This familiar style will allow RPG fans to feel right at home, allowing them to enjoy an original storyline in a classic gaming environment.
Look & Feel
Graphically, Weird War resembles a classic RPG's. The world is depicted in an isometric view that is centers on you as you move throughout the environment. An intuitive icon-based interface allows you to issue team commands for movement, combat, inventory management and character statistics.
Combat occurs often in Weird War and takes place in real time. During the course of each battle, you can pause the game, which freezes combat, but still allows you to issue commands and access each character's inventory.
In Weird War most dialogs and descriptions are displayed as they are in most other RPGs, the person you are addressing will speak and any options available to you will appear in a dialogue selection afterwards.
Features:
* Original storyline, full of surprises, humorous plot describing the untold secrets of World War II.
* 3 theatres with 150 exciting locations distributed across the exotic backdrop of Africa and unique regions of Europe.
* Nonlinear gameplay, over 75 quests and exhilarating interaction with NPC's, objects, and parts of the environment.
* Spectacular combat with over forty different types of demanding opponents and more then fifty types of weapons.
* 3 classes of characters, 7 specializations and a variety of almost 50 unique skills available.
* Fully configurable appearance of the Player Character and Non-Player Characters. Over 60 pieces of equipment that influence character appearance and abilities.
Weird War - The Unknown Episode of World War II is set to be released in Q3/Q4 2003.
